Finished Floor Installation in Fort Worth, TX
Finished floor installation services involve the process of adding new flooring materials to enhance the appearance, functionality, and value of a property. This service covers a variety of projects, including replacing worn-out flooring, upgrading to new styles such as hardwood, laminate, tile, or vinyl, and completing new construction or remodeling projects. Homeowners typically seek this service to improve the aesthetics of living spaces, create a more durable surface, or match existing decor, making it an essential step in many renovation plans.
Property owners should consider factors such as the type of flooring material that best suits their lifestyle, the condition of subflooring, and the overall design goals before requesting installation services. Understanding the scope of work, including surface preparation, removal of old flooring, and finishing details, helps ensure the project meets expectations. Clarifying these aspects in advance can facilitate a smooth installation process and result in a finished floor that complements the property’s style and meets daily needs.

Finished Floor Installation Questions
What types of flooring can be installed? Various options include hardwood, laminate, vinyl, tile, and carpet, suitable for different rooms and styles.
Is floor preparation needed before installation? Yes, existing surfaces may need to be leveled or repaired to ensure proper installation and durability.
What should property owners consider when choosing flooring? Consider factors like durability, maintenance, style, and suitability for the specific room or use.
Can finished floors be installed over existing flooring? In some cases, new flooring can be installed over existing surfaces, but proper assessment is recommended.
